In-N-Out Leadership

Credit: youtube.com, How Lynsi Snyder Transformed In-N-Out’s Company Culture | Leadership

Lynsi Snyder's leadership style is deeply rooted in her personal values, including her faith and her commitment to the principles her grandparents established.

She inherited 50% of In-N-Out's shares on her 30th birthday in 2012 and became the sole owner at 35 in 2017.

Under her guidance, In-N-Out has expanded cautiously but effectively, with over 385 locations primarily on the West Coast and in a few southern states.

Stepping Into Leadership

Lynsi Snyder became the sole owner of In-N-Out at 35 in 2017, despite having no formal business training.

She took the reins with determination to uphold her family's vision, deeply rooted in her personal values, including her faith and her commitment to the principles her grandparents established.

Snyder's leadership style is a key factor in the company's success, as it has allowed In-N-Out to expand cautiously but effectively.

Under her guidance, the company now has over 385 locations, primarily on the West Coast and in a few southern states.

In-N-Out has resisted the pressure to franchise or expand too quickly, a strategy that has preserved the company's quality and its tightly-knit, family-run atmosphere.

Snyder's approach has paid off, allowing the company to maintain its unique culture and values.

Personal Life

Lynsi Snyder is a devoted mother who prioritizes her family. She shares a passion for drag racing with her husband, Sean Ellingson.

As a devoted mother, Snyder values the importance of family. She attributes her success to her family's legacy and her faith.

Snyder remains grounded despite her immense wealth, estimated at over $7 billion.
